What is the Biography of O-Town?

O-Town was formed in 2000 through the reality show "Making the Band," which was created by music producer Lou Pearlman. The original lineup consisted of five members: Erik-Michael Estrada, Trevor Penick, Jacob Underwood, Dan Miller, and Ashley Parker Angel. The group quickly gained popularity and released their self-titled debut album in 2001, which went on to achieve commercial success.

How Did O-Town Achieve Success?

O-Town's initial success can be attributed to a combination of talent, strategic marketing, and the appeal of reality television. The show's format allowed viewers to connect with the band members on a personal level, fostering a loyal fan base. Their first major single, "All or Nothing," became a massive hit, reaching the top of the charts and solidifying their place in pop music history.

What Challenges Did O-Town Face Over the Years?

Despite their early success, O-Town faced several challenges that tested their resolve. The pressures of fame and the music industry took a toll on the group, leading to a hiatus in 2004. During this time, members pursued solo careers, but the desire to reunite never faded. In 2013, O-Town made a comeback, much to the delight of their fans.
